Über den Kurs
Phyton / Microphyton Übersicht
- Interpreter / Scriptsprache
- nicht typisiert (neuerdings möglich)
- Objektorientiert
- man muss aber nicht OOP programmieren
- Alles ist ein Objekt
- OOP-Notation findet man ständig
- aktuell 3.11
- Microphyton basiert auf Phyton 3.4 / 3.5
- Microphyton aktuell Version 1.20
- M5Stack-Firmware basiert auf Microphyton 1.12
- Phyton ist einfach
- nur wenige Schlüsselworte (Keywords)
- aber mächtig durch Module (Bibliotheken)
- Lesbarkeit
- Einrückungen
- Style Guide for Phyton Code (PEP8)
- Phyton Enhancement Proposals = Vorschläge zur Verbesserung von Phyton
- Phytonisch
Informationsquellen
Thonny
- Was ist Thonny
- Programme für Phyton schreiben:
- Editor
- Windows Editor
- notepad++
- Sublime Text
- Atom
- IDE
- Mu Editor
- µPyCraft IDE
- Thonny
- PyCharm
- Visual Studio Code
Thonny installieren
Nur kurz beschreiben.
Alle müssen zu Beginn des Kurses ein lauffähiges Thonny auf ihrem Laptop haben!
- Windows
- Das Programm von https://thonny.org herunterladen
- Programm starten
- Fertig
- Das Zielverzeichnis lässt sich nicht auswählen
- Ältere Versionen werden überschrieben
- Portabelversion läßt sich parallel installieren
Thonny kennenlernen
- Einführung in Thonny
- Die verschiedenen Bereiche und ihre Verwendung
- Editorfenster
- Terminalfenster
- Navigieren mit Hoch- und Runtertaste
- "_" holt den letzten Wert
- Dateifenster
- Werkzeuge/Optionen.../Interpreter
- Vor Start des Skripts Interpreter neu starten abschalten
- Gerät auswählen
- Erstes Programm: Begrüßung.py
Die REPL
- Read Modify Print Loop / EVA
- Interaktiv mit dem Interpreter kommunizieren.
Navigation
Zurück zur Microphyton_Kurs_2023 Startseite
Zurück zur Programmieren Startseite
Zurück zur Wiki Startseite